A pool presents a wonderful opportunity for recreation, but it's crucial to prioritize safety. Fencing plays a vital role in deterring accidents, especially involving young children and pets. When determining the right pool fence, consider these essential factors.
* **Height:** The fence should stand at least 6 more info feet tall to effectively hinder access.
* **Material:** Durable materials like aluminum provide long-lasting protection.
* **Gate Latch:** Opt for a robust gate latch that is high enough for children.
* **Self-Closing and Self-Latching:** Ensure the gate self-latches after use, preventing accidental openings.
Regularly inspect your fence for damage and make prompt repairs to maintain a safe barrier around your pool area.
Pool Fence Installation
Securing your pool with a sturdy fence is vital in preventing accidents. Before you begin the installation process, meticulously consider local building codes and regulations to ensure compliance. Acquire all required authorizations ahead of time to avoid any delays or complications during construction.
Choose a fence material that best suits your needs and budget. Common options include wood, vinyl, aluminum, and chain link, each with distinct characteristics. Once you've chosen your preferred material, plan the layout of your pool fence. Mark the perimeter using stakes and string to guide your installation process.
The depth of your foundation will depend on the chosen material and local frost line regulations. Preparing the ground for your fence posts should be done carefully. Ensure that the holes are level and wide enough to accommodate the posts securely.
Set up the posts in their respective holes, using a level to ensure they are plumb. Securely support them while the concrete cures.
Once the concrete sets, you can begin attaching the fence panels using appropriate hardware, following the manufacturer's instructions.
A properly installed pool fence offers protection to prevent children and pets from gaining access. Regularly inspect your fence for any damage or wear for optimal safety.

Reducing Drowning Accidents: The Importance of Pool Fences
Protecting your family out of drowning accidents is paramount. A key step in achieving this goal is installing a secure pool fence. These barriers serve as a physical obstruction to young children and pets, preventing unsupervised access to the water. A well-maintained pool fence can significantly lower the risk of tragic drownings. It's a simple investment that provides invaluable peace of mind.
Remember, supervision is always crucial, but a sturdy pool fence acts as an essential layer of protection, giving you added confidence while your loved ones enjoy time near the water.
